Icing up reconstituted peptides is typically not advised. Ice crystal development during cold can physically damage peptide framework, and thawing presents additional stress. The majority of peptide producers specifically advise against cold reconstituted options. Instead, refrigerate reconstituted peptides and utilize within the recommended duration, normally days to weeks relying on the solvent used. Most reconstituted peptides remain steady for 2 to 4 weeks under ideal refrigeration at 2-8 ° C . This duration presumes correct reconstitution technique, appropriate diluent selection, and constant cold store without temperature level tours.

Nitrogen or argon blankets displace oxygen from the vial headspace, producing an atmosphere where oxidation can not continue. Several suppliers supply peptides currently packaged under nitrogen, which gives protection till the vial Direct Peptides USA is very first opened. Research study reveals that also little rises in wetness web content can have outsized effects at elevated temperature levels. The dampness decreases the glass transition temperature of the dried peptide cake, enabling molecular flexibility to resume and destruction reactions to proceed.
